Why bird activity is a serious risk in refineries and chemical plants
Large industrial sites provide ideal conditions for birds to roost, nest, and establish. In a refinery or chemical plant environment, this creates risks that go beyond a standard pest problem:
- Equipment damage: Bird droppings are highly corrosive and accelerate the deterioration of pipework, valves, structural steelwork, and electrical components
- Contamination risks: Droppings, feathers, and nesting debris can contaminate sensitive processing areas and compromise product integrity
- Blocked drainage and ventilation: Nesting materials accumulate in drainage systems and ventilation units, increasing the risk of blockages and unplanned maintenance
- Fire and electrical hazards: Nesting materials near electrical installations and heat sources create a serious fire risk
- Worker health and safety: Bird droppings carry harmful bacteria and pathogens that pose health risks to on-site personnel
In environments where a single failure can have significant safety and financial consequences, these risks demand a proactive response.
High-risk areas in refineries and chemical plants
Certain areas on these sites are especially vulnerable to bird activity:
- Pipe racks, structural steelwork, and elevated platforms
- Electrical substations and control rooms
- Cooling towers and ventilation systems
- Storage tanks and processing units
- Loading and offloading areas
- Administration buildings and worker facilities
These structures offer shelter, warmth, and elevated vantage points that birds are naturally drawn to.
Flock Reduction Program as the foundation
On large refinery and chemical plant sites with established pigeon populations, a Flock Reduction Program forms the essential first step in any bird management strategy.
This program uses a controlled conditioning method – a specialised oral contraceptive feed system – delivered through automated Flock Reducer units positioned strategically across the site. These units dispense a measured daily feed consumed by the existing pigeon population.
Over time, this approach:
- Stabilises and gradually reduces flock size across the site
- Limits conditions that encourage new birds to settle
- Reduces population pressure ahead of physical exclusion installations
This is particularly effective on large, complex sites where immediate full exclusion is not practical.
Effective bird control solutions for refineries and chemical plants
A successful program requires a layered, site-specific approach:
Bird Netting
Installed to restrict bird access to processing units, pipe racks, electrical rooms, and structural openings. Bird netting provides a durable physical barrier suited to the harsh conditions of refinery environments.
Bird Spikes
Applied to structural steelwork, pipework supports, ledges, and elevated platforms to prevent landing and roosting in critical areas – without causing harm to birds.
Bird Mesh and Nest Removal
Removes existing nesting material from drainage systems, ventilation units, and structural cavities, preventing blockages and reducing fire risk near heat sources and electrical installations.
Targeted Deterrents
Used across open areas of the site to discourage bird congregation near processing units and worker facilities without disrupting plant operations.

The importance of ongoing monitoring
Refinery and chemical plant environments are complex and constantly evolving. Bird control is not a once-off intervention.
Regular inspections and maintenance ensure that netting, spikes, and deterrent systems remain effective over time. Ongoing monitoring allows the program to adapt as site conditions change, keeping control measures relevant and operational at all times.
